Adam: Fixing the ByWard Market — we'll still need places to park

March 20, 2025
As Ottawa residents debate how to revive our treasured but troubled ByWard Market, the most significant development to watch is the city’s $129-million public realm plan, which aims to transform the historic district into a largely pedestrian-friendly enclave. Read More
